I had a leftover slice of pastrami one night but wanted pasta of some kind, so I made up this recipe.
The pastrami merely served as the saltiness. You could easily add bacon, ham, shrimp, etc., or no meat at all, still use a bit of olive oil to saute the spinach.

Jan’s Surprisingly Good Spaghetti!

Large serving cooked spaghetti
While spaghetti cooks,
sauté large slice pastrami, diced, in olive oil
Add and stir til wilted:
Juice of 1 lemon
Half container organic baby spinach leaves
Add:
Shake of garlic, Italian seasoning, salt, pepper
Toss spaghetti in grated parmesan then top with spinach mix and toss.
